SUMMARY
The Accounting Manager position reports directly to the Operational Sr. Accounting Manager and is responsible to work with a team that provides accounting support and analysis throughout the month to acquired companies and our multiple segments. The Accounting Manager is also a key element to interact with various groups in the Company, including Operational and Corporate personnel, to establish, monitor and/or clarify accounting policies in accordance with GAAP and Company's policy, and to prepare, analyze and present the segments' financial results to senior management.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S
- Responsible for managing the daily operations of the accounting team, which includes identifying and solving accounting and business issues as they arise.
- Prepare and present variance analysis for the segments balance sheets and income statements monthly and/or quarterly.
- Prepare, analyze and present financial reporting packages for the operational and environmental segments.
- Responsible for the financial accounting and reporting of acquired companies.
- Manage the month-end accounting activities to report the segment's financial results timely and accurately.
- Assist with financial planning preparation.
- Provide guidance to the accounting team and across the Operational accounting structure by assisting, training and developing them in accounting resolutions, guidance and companies' policies to ensure accounting processes and controls are maintained effectively.
- Coordinate with internal and external auditors and provide needed information for audit requirements.
- Assist senior management with process improvement ideas and implementations.
- Participate in ad hoc projects as needed
